예제 #1
0
 private void generateReaderMotionToolStripMenuItem_Click(object sender, EventArgs e)
 {
     IOTGlobal global = (IOTGlobal)Global.getInstance();
     MoveForm f = new MoveForm();
     DialogResult r = f.ShowDialog();
     if (f.ok != true)
         return;
     int nodeCount = (int)(global.readerNum * f.nodeRatio);
     double nodeSpeed = f.nodeSpeed;
     int eventCount = f.eventCount;
     bool clear = f.clear;
     EventGenerator generator = new EventGenerator();
     if (clear)
         generator.ClearEvents("MOV");
     generator.GenerateRandomObjectMotionEvents(true, true, nodeSpeed, eventCount, nodeCount, NodeType.READER);
     MessageBox.Show("Done");
 }
예제 #2
0
 private void generateObjectMotionsToolStripMenuItem_Click(object sender, EventArgs e)
 {
     IOTGlobal global = (IOTGlobal)Global.getInstance();
     MoveForm f = new MoveForm();
     f.ShowDialog();
     if (f.ok != true)
         return;
     //if (f.DialogResult != System.Windows.Forms.DialogResult.OK)
     //    return;
     int nodeCount = (int)(global.objectNum * f.nodeRatio);
     double nodeSpeed = f.nodeSpeed;
     int eventCount = f.eventCount;
     bool clear = f.clear;
     EventGenerator generator = new EventGenerator();
     if (clear)
         generator.ClearEvents("MOV");
     generator.GenerateRandomObjectMotionEvents(true, false, nodeSpeed, eventCount, nodeCount, NodeType.OBJECT);
     MessageBox.Show("Done");
 }